$2M, $1M and 2 $500K lottery prizes claimed in Mass. on Tuesday
Lottery prizes worth $2 million, $1 million and two worth $500,000 were all claimed in Massachusetts on Tuesday. The $2 million prize was from “$2,000,000 Stacked,” a $20 scratch ticket game released in February. There are still 11 $2 million grand prizes remaining to be claimed in the game as of May 27.

Bill would push last call to 3 a.m. across Mass. this summer
Legislation introduced would allow Massachusetts restaurants and bars to stay open later this summer when the 2026 FIFA World Cup comes to Foxborough.
